I don't stutter alone, I only stutter with a person. Why? Answer: because in my experience when I'm alone I think: "I'll say what I want to say". When I'm with a person I change this thought into insecurity: "I"ll stutter on this and this". The obvious question is, how do we change the thought I"ll stutter to I'll say what I want to say?
